Scatterbrain

Scatterbrain

1940 · 73 min · ★ 7.5 · Comedy, Music

A Hollywood studio goofs and signs the wrong girl--a hillbilly from the Ozarks--to a movie contract. Comedy.

Directed by Gus Meins · Written by Val Burton
